iOS 18.4 Update Explained: New Emojis, Wallet, and More

Apple’s iOS 18.4 update is set to deliver a more refined and polished experience for iPhone and iPad users. With over 50 new features and improvements, this update emphasizes usability, bug fixes, and performance enhancements rather than introducing new innovations. Scheduled for public release on April 7, 2024, following extensive beta testing, iOS 18.4 aims to make your device more efficient, reliable, and user-friendly.

Key Features and Updates

iOS 18.4 brings a range of practical updates designed to enhance functionality and streamline your daily interactions. These updates focus on improving usability while adding subtle yet meaningful enhancements to the user experience. Notable features include:

  • New Emojis: The emoji keyboard now includes a broader selection of emojis, making it easier to find and use expressive icons in your messages. This update caters to users who enjoy personalizing their communication with creative visuals.
  • Wallet App Redesign: The “Payments and subscriptions” section has been replaced with a more intuitive “Pre-authorized payments” feature. This redesign simplifies transaction management, offering a cleaner and more user-friendly interface.
  • Podcast App Enhancements: A new splash screen introduces updated widgets for your library and followed shows, improving navigation and making it easier to access your favorite content.
  • Gen Moji Integration: WhatsApp now supports Gen Moji, allowing users to create and share personalized avatars seamlessly within their chats. This feature adds a layer of customization to your messaging experience.

These updates aim to make everyday tasks more convenient while adding a touch of personalization to your interactions, making sure that iOS 18.4 caters to a wide range of user preferences.

Bug Fixes and Interface Improvements

Apple has addressed several persistent issues in iOS 18.4, focusing on enhancing the overall stability and reliability of the system. These fixes target common frustrations reported by users, making sure a smoother experience. Key improvements include:

  • Control Center Animations: Animations for clearing notifications and performing other actions are now more fluid, reducing visual lag and enhancing the interface’s responsiveness.
  • Type to Siri: Responsiveness issues with the “Type to Siri” feature have been resolved, making interactions with Siri more dependable and efficient.
  • Control Center Dismissal: Problems with dismissing the Control Center have been fixed, contributing to a more polished and seamless user interface.

These updates reflect Apple’s commitment to addressing user feedback and making sure that iOS 18.4 delivers a more reliable and enjoyable experience.

Performance and Battery Life

Performance optimization remains a central focus in iOS 18.4. While Geekbench scores indicate slightly lower performance compared to iOS 18.3, the difference is minimal and unlikely to impact everyday tasks for most users. Apple continues to fine-tune battery life during the beta phase, with further refinements expected before the final release. These adjustments aim to strike a balance between performance and energy efficiency, making sure that your device operates smoothly throughout the day.

For users concerned about battery longevity, iOS 18.4 demonstrates Apple’s ongoing efforts to optimize power consumption without compromising performance. This balance is particularly important for those who rely on their devices for extended periods.

Release Timeline and Future Outlook

iOS 18.4 is currently in its third beta phase, with additional beta updates expected throughout March 2024. The Release Candidate (RC) version is anticipated by late March or early April, paving the way for the public release on April 7, 2024. During this period, Apple is expected to focus on fine-tuning the update and addressing any remaining issues.

Looking ahead, Apple has hinted at significant updates to Siri in iOS 19, positioning iOS 18.4 as a transitional update. While it may not introduce major new features, its primary goal is to refine existing functionalities and improve overall stability. This approach lays the groundwork for more substantial changes in future releases, making sure that iOS continues to evolve in response to user needs.
